Abstract
Prionopathy is the cause of 62% of the rapidly progressive dementias (RPD) in which a definitive diagnosis is reached. The variability of symptoms and signs exhibited by the patients, as well as its different presentation, sometimes makes an early diagnosis difficult. Patients with diagnosis of definite or probable prionopathy during the period 1999–2012 at our hospital were retrospectively reviewed. The clinical features and the results of the...
